Output ae93bf6c3bcc9dcf294a9a12fe5e49ca8af9be9d5d831ebbfc6e979cf5e1a641:18

value
86559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ae9381902ef70753b5cd62c1c2c55db9640b5865 OP_EQUAL
address
3Hc6CpsZ2yravci4n94ZbQsVmDYhfYe8hs
transaction
ae93bf6c3bcc9dcf294a9a12fe5e49ca8af9be9d5d831ebbfc6e979cf5e1a641
spent
true